This game is developed to criticize the notion of the right way to play digital games. This game is designed in a way where the player has the freedom to play in different ways to a certain extent. However, there is a fictional 3rd party application, Player Assistance System (PAS), that evaluates player performance to improve. PAS gives feedback to discourage and punish the player no matter which decision the player makes. The goal of this project is to criticize the so-called right ways to play that regulate players and exclude the ones that don’t invest time and money to learn the metagame. It is totally possible to win the game if you see beyond the meta. But does it really matter to win?
